Transaction ecf6b436d06fdc06eff88ed5dc0b3025aaa32e7b04d9952a42cac8a0b3c4a3e7
1 Input
1 Output
-
ecf6b436d06fdc06eff88ed5dc0b3025aaa32e7b04d9952a42cac8a0b3c4a3e7:0
- value
- 72516
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 43f6a1be0fecd19a586c7432f518d0d136d3e706 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17CMj8bZc7krckDx2b3gWwvTyPnPQG8VF3